Foundation repair services involve assessing and fixing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include inspections to identify signs of foundation problems, such as c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ly. Once problems are diagnosed, contractors may perform various repairs, including underpinning, pier installation, or stabilization techniques to restore the foundation’s stability and prevent further damage. Proper foundation repair helps ensure that a home remains safe, level, and structurally sound over time.
Many foundation issues are caused by shifting soil, moisture changes, or settling that occurs naturally over time. Common problems addressed by foundation repair include cracked or bowing walls, gaps around door frames, and uneven or sagging floors. If these issues are left untreated, they can lead to more serious structural damage, increased repair costs, and safety concerns. Foundation repair services are designed to correct these problems early, helping to maintain the integrity of the property and prevent further de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hendersonville,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ation repairs in Hendersonville range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as small crack repairs or minor stabilization, fall within this range. Larger or more complex small jobs may approach the upper end of this spectrum.
Moderate Projects - Medium-sized foundation repairs often cost between $1,000-$3,500. These projects might include partial foundation stabilization or fixing multiple cracks, which are common for local homes.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this range.
Major Repairs - Extensive foundation work, such as significant underpinning or extensive wall stabilization, can range from $4,000-$8,000. These larger projects are less frequent but necessary for homes with serious issues requiring substantial work.
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acement in Hendersonville typically costs $20,000-$50,000 or more. Such projects are rare and involve extensive excavation and construction, handled by specialized local contractors, with costs varying based on size and compl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How do professionals typically repair foundation issues? Repair methods often involve underpinning, slab jacking, or wall stabilization, depending on the type and severity of the problem.
Can foundation problems lead to other structural issues? Yes, unresolved foundation issues can cause additional damage to the building's structure, including cracked walls and compromised support beams.
What factors contribute to foundation damage in Hendersonville, NC? Factors include soil movement, moisture fluctuations, tree roots, and poor initial construction practices.
